Custom Translator not working properly in some cases
I was using custom translator, but the translation is different from that which is defined in dictionary in few cases.
[Details]
Subscription : S1
Region : US West
API Endpoint : https://api.cognitive.microsofttranslator.com/translate/?api- version=3.0&category=XXX&from=en&to=es&allowFallback=false
Training type : Dictionary-only Training
Trained dictionary type : Phrase Dictionary
Language pair : English - Spanish (Espanol)
Data in phrase dictionary
English | Spanish |
---|---|
Cat | Cat |
Dog | Dog |
Bat | Bat |
Ball | Ball |
Below mentioned are few scenarios where it isn't working.
- request : "Cat" response : "Gato" (default translation response) ❌ expected response : "Cat"
- request : "Dog" response : "Perro" (default translation response) ❌ expected response : "Dog"
- same issue for "Bat" and "Ball"
BUT, when my request is a sentence instead of a word, it seems to be working fine ???
- request : "I need a Cat." response : "Necesito un Cat." ✅ expected response : "Necesito un Cat."
- request : "I need a Dog." response : "Necesito un Dog." ✅ expected response : "Necesito un Dog."
AND, I came across this unique scenario
- request : "I have a Cat." response : "Tengo un gato." (default translation response) ❌ expected response : "Tengo un Cat."
- request : "I have a Dog." esponse : "Tengo un Dog." ✅ expected response : "Tengo un Dog."
- I got correct responses for "Bat" and "Ball" sentences. ✅
I have tried with other words as well, but didn't get expected translation response (when the request is just a word). I got correct responses when I used those words in a sentence as mentioned above.
Is it that single word translations are not supported ?
And for the word "Cat", Even when I used it in a sentence I got default translation in few cases as mentioned above.
